Bulk image downloader 5 is a major upgrade of the application. After creating a new android project, we should create a volley singleton. Which software can download images from urls listed in a. In the layout design, button click will start an asynctask class to begin downloading an image from a url address specified in the edittext control in your android application. Glide is probably the easiest and the most efficient way to load image to an imageview. Many ckan features that need an absolute url to your site use this setting. Android load image from url in this android code tutorial, we are going to learn how to load image from a url or internet in android. If you download the original image files, the image id is the same as the filename excluding the format extension. A scalingmethod can be set on the imageview to specify how or if the image should be scaled in any way to fit the dimensions of the image view heres how to create an image view in qml. This page covers android load image from url with internet using bitmapfactory and imageview.
Url image to bitmap imageview android tutorials youtube. To access internet required permission is internet. In the users post he asks a similar question and suggest he uses. Create a member variable for the imageview in your layout file. Images are cached to memory and to disk for super fast loading.
How to convert image file formats on android jpg, png, tif, psd, bmp, gif, jp2, webp etc duration. How to download files with urlsession using combine publishers. Jul 10, 2012 tutorial about loading an image from into imageview. Jun 09, 2018 a nodejs module for downloading image to disk from a given url demskingimage downloader. Androids asynctask for download asynchronously an image from. The urls are listed in a single txt file, where each line contains an image id and the original url. Using custom adapter to create lisview rows and using imageloader class to lazy load images from web and show in listview row. Type url of a chosen webpage and get a list or a table of all its images with information about them by clicking list images magnifying glass button. Perhaps we often use imageview to display an image from drawable, you may have heard about the image url with the. To create a temporary file we need to access device external storage. Android load image from url with internet using bitmapfactory. In this tutorial, we will see how to load an image from url into android imageview. What youll need to do is download the image from the internet locally, and then load it from the file system.
Picasso android tutorial load image from url in this tutorial you will learn how to use picasso android library to load image from url. Create a new project in android studio, go to file. Also the internet permission is required in the android. After seeing the demo video just start a new android application project on your computer. Asynchronous image downloader with cache support as a uiimageview category. So in this tutorial we are loading our websites logo inside imageview using asynctask class. This blog gives you a step by step guide to display image from url with source code for android studio. If you want to load an image from your web url into android imageview in your android application, this blog is for you.
Asking for help, clarification, or responding to other answers. Picasso is an open source android library which is developed and maintained by square. Just to take given urls, download the bitmaps and set them to the imageview then add them to the cache. Mostrar imagen con url en android entre desarrolladores. If an image was found in the cache either in memory or disk, sets it to imageview. Viewurlimageviewcache mit license sharakovaurlimageview. So here is the complete step by step tutorial for load image inside imageview. How do i properly set up volley to download images from a url.
Apr 26, 2016 if you want to load an image from your web url into android imageview in your android application, this blog is for you. Nov 17, 2017 in this kotlin programming tutorial i am going to share with you how to load image from a remote url in kotlin using glide. To get more information about different functions and options hover over input labels and question marks. Oct 19, 2017 perhaps we often use imageview to display an image from drawable, you may have heard about the image url with the. This example demonstrates about how do i load an imageview on android using picasso. Imageview is an image viewing application, which plugs into the default windows interface and provides additional support for functions that extend the usability of imageviewing processes and image manipulation. New project and fill all required details to create a new project step 2. I have a text file which contains the url of the images that i want to download. Image from url in imageview xamarin community forums.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. The new version introduced several new features and options to the application which all of its users will benefit from. Sign up android library that sets an imageview s contents from a url.
In my previous post, i presented an overview of volley, the official networking library in android. Sep 03, 20 populate an imageview widget in android app using an image which is fetched from a url. Owidig online webpage image downloader and imageinfo. Tutorial on download image using asynctask tutorial in android, you will learn how to download an image using url address into your android application.
Set image to a imageview from url duplicate ask question asked 5 years. How to load image from url with picasso library in android. An image downloader software is used basically to find a link to download an. By now you must have realized that cascades and qml make user. Tutorial on download image using asynctask tutorial in. Which software can download images from urls listed in a text file. In this video, we will see how to load image from url with picasso library in android studio. If not, creates a request and download it from url. Please refer to having issue on real device using vector image in android.
This application allows you to download images from url list file. These are all the steps to create a project in android studio. You can use glide to load a local image and well as an image hosted on a remote server. In this example well learn how to use qnetworkaccessmanager and qtconcurrent to download an image file asynchronously from the network and then offload the timeconsuming task of. Owidig online webpage image downloader and imageinfo grabber. Using lazy loading to download images in a listview. Download images by asynctask in listview android example. A scalingmethod can be set on the imageview to specify how or if the image should be scaled in any way to fit the dimensions of the image view. Displaying images is easiest using a third party library such as picasso from square which will download and cache remote images and abstract the complexity behind an easy to use dsl.
In this example downloading images from web to a listview. In this kotlin programming tutorial i am going to share with you how to load image from a remote url in kotlin using glide. Its only design to read from a local uri to the file system. Download imageview this gadget is a simple image viewer that also features a slideshow function. The best way to maintain volley core objects and request queue is, making them global by creating a singleton class which extends application. This example demonstrates how do i download image from url in android. For downloading the image from url and loading it in imageview, we use asynctask. Dec 28, 2016 how to convert image file formats on android jpg, png, tif, psd, bmp, gif, jp2, webp etc duration.
So, is there any software that i can use to download these image. While building the android app by using the mvvm architecture design pattern with kotlin, i faced many of issue for example data binding and viewmodel communication etc. Populate an imageview widget in android app using an image which is fetched from a url. An issues while loading images with picasso comment down below.
Set image to a imageview from url duplicate ask question asked 5 years, 9 months ago. Download images by asynctask in listview android example james liu june 15, 20 9. A nodejs module for downloading image to disk from a given url demskingimage downloader. You can also use a path thats relative to the location of the. Androids asynctask for download asynchronously an image from an url and assign it to an imageview downloadimagetask. The integrated bulk image downloader is capable of taking a list of urls from the same, or completely different websites and visiting each url and downloading all the images contained on the page. Androids asynctask for download asynchronously an image. Loading image through url is very easy with the use of asynctask android class. Tutorial about loading an image from into imageview. Aug 24, 2015 this page covers android load image from url with internet using bitmapfactory and imageview. The free image downloader is a freeware version that can extract the image files from a specified url link that the user provides inside the software with.
Download images from web and lazy load in listview. Using nineslice scaling can help minimize the size and number of image assets that you bundle with your app. So if the website has a gallery, or a page of images you are able to download them all locally on your pc. I am sharing one of the issues which i faced to load image url on image view with help of picasso. The image itself can be set using either an image object or a path specifying the location of an image. Hover over advanced settings for more options and over downloads options to download listed files. What i want to do is download a picture from the internet to my android application and apply it to an imageview. Nineslice scaling is a technique that is typically used for background and border images.
Displaying images with the picasso library codepath android. How to load image from url in imageview in android youtube. Code issues 20 pull requests 4 actions projects 3 wiki security insights. It allows an image to scale to virtually any size while keeping its corners sharp and borders uniform. To download the image the qnetworkaccessmanager class is used and. In this android code tutorial, we are going to learn how to load image from a url or internet in android. The image loader example demonstrates how to offload work intensive tasks into seperate work threads, and than report show their results asynchronously.
Adding picasso library to your android studio project. It supports multiple image formats, including popular formats such as jpeg, gif, and pcx, for viewing and editing. Internet connection shall be required in this case. To work with internet we need a separate thread otherwise we will get android. The downloader ui just contains an input field for the url, a download and a close button and a status label. There are situations when you may need to download an image using the url path of the image in your android application. Possibility of wide tuning imageloaders configuration thread executors, downloader, decoder, memory and disc cache, display image options, and others. Picasso library is very compact and small library it could be easily implement in your project via build. Thanks for contributing an answer to stack overflow.
If you download the original image files, the image id is the same. Load image from a remote url with kotlin and glide apps. By this post, i will present the way to request online data html string, json objectarray, image bitmap which available in an url and parsing it after. Load image url on imageview by using data binding with. How to load an imageview by url on android using picasso. Jan 30, 20 download imageview this gadget is a simple image viewer that also features a slideshow function. Download images from web and lazy load in listview android. In your oncreate method, you need to load that view by calling setcontentviewresource. Before using picasso, do not forget to add internet permission in the manifest file. The user simply needs to copy and paste the website url in which they are in need of images to download from. Jun 20, 2017 bulk image downloader 5 is a major upgrade of the application.